Bricks! Here are some of those, in a big tube, and you are in it. But how???
Well, the bricks are redrawn frame-by-frame, but I made this "digital grid" as a guide to draw over. A grid is a useful guide to have when making any pattern conform to a warping surface, but especially convenient for bricks, because they are almost a grid already.
This is not the final shot- the bricks still need to undergo a bunch of compositing to match the more painterly bricks from other background...

My films are made digitally (mostly). Usually, the final designs, as well as the animation, are both made entirely in the computer since the animation methods impact the design. But when I hit a mental roadblock, I’ll often turn to paper and rapidly fire out scribbly ideas until a way forward opens up, at which point I will throw down the sketchbook and go back to the computer. The sketchbook usually doesn’t get the dignity of containing anything close to a final design, and because I wor...

It was 2016. I'd managed to save up some money the previous year, and so I thought I would take a break from freelancing to work on Double King full time and get it finished. But of course, the savings had nearly run out before Double King was anywhere near done. And when you freelance, it’s not like you can just take on a shift either- it requires a couple months of hunting and negotiating...
